Hello, Newbie Postbox member here.

I've successfully added my iCloud email but although I've now got all my email user folders copied over (some automatically some not quite so automatically!) my Sent folder did not transfer.  Postbox instructions state that I need to export this from Mail and then Import but the emails will then appear in 'Imported folder'.  I want them to appear in the Sent folder and for subsequent emails sent from Postbox to be added to them.  Am I hoping for too much?

You should be okay. Just right-click and move from imported folder to sent folder. You can verify Sent folder for future use by checking Tools>Options>Accounts>Copies & Folders.
